March 2025 monthly highlights for adobe/aio-cli-plugin-api-mesh: focused on stabilizing the mesh build workflow and improving maintainability. Delivered a critical bug fix to ensure tenant files are copied for both runtime and worker builds, preventing build-time errors when mesh configurations lack additional files. Performed non-functional maintenance by updating dependencies and cleaning up code quality in the api-mesh run script, reducing technical debt and aligning with current metadata. These changes preserve functionality while lowering risk in deployments and future maintenance.
